Trikatu-The Three Spices Formula (Baidyanath)
Trikatu means the Three Pungents and it is used to help maintain a healthy respiratory system. Ginger, Black Pepper and Long Pepper are mixed together to stimulate the system, warm the digestion and improve assimilation of nutrients. It is traditionally used for lung and nasal problems. It is specific for allergic rhinitis, hayfever and colds. It is used in Ayurveda as part of a weight loss regime to increase metabolism, digest fats and balance appetite. It is traditionally taken with honey. Use before meals as a deepaniya- a digestive stimulant and after meals as a pachaniya- as an aid to digestion.
Ayurvedic Energetics: Specific for low Agni and high Ama, weak digestive fire and accumulation of toxins; reduces Kaha and Vata, increases Pitta. Trikatu is used mainly to control conditions in which kapha or ama obstructs Vata.
